前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
工具
TVP
发布
社区首页 >专栏 >Pandas-29.通用方法-crosstab

Pandas-29.通用方法-crosstab

作者头像
悠扬前奏
发布2019-05-30 14:31:35
5720
发布2019-05-30 14:31:35
举报

方法签名:

代码语言:javascript
复制
`pandas.``crosstab`(*index*, *columns*, *values=None*, *rownames=None*, *colnames=None*, *aggfunc=None*, *margins=False*, *margins_name='All'*, *dropna=True*, *normalize=False*)

计算两个或多个因子的简单交叉列表,默认计算所有因子的频次表,除非传递了一组值和一个聚合函数。

参数:

  • index:类数组,Series,数组/Series的列表,用于行分组的值
  • columns:类数组,Series,数组/Series的列表,用于列分组的值
  • values:类数组,可选,用于根据因子聚合的列表,需要制定聚合函数
  • rownames:队列,默认None,如果指定,必须和传递的行队列数匹配
  • colnames:队列,默认None,如果指定,和传递的队列数匹配
  • aggfunc:函数,如果指定,values需要指定
  • margins:boolean,默认False,添加行/列聚合
  • margins_name:聚合的名称
  • dropna:是否不包含NaN值
  • normalize:boolean, {‘all’, ‘index’, ‘columns’}, or {0,1}, default False Normalize by dividing all values by the sum of values.
    • If passed ‘all’ or True, will normalize over all values.
    • If passed ‘index’ will normalize over each row.
    • If passed ‘columns’ will normalize over each column.
    • If margins is True, will also normalize margin values.
本文参与 腾讯云自媒体分享计划,分享自作者个人站点/博客。
原始发表:2019.04.14 ,如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 作者个人站点/博客 前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体分享计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
0 条评论
热度
最新
推荐阅读
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档